Causes of cancer in different organs of human body?

Lung cancer: the top of the list for both men and women. Why are the lungs so vulnerable? In terms of the current analysis of cancer-causing causes, there are two main points, the first is smoking. According to statistics, 30% of tumor incidence is related to long-term smoking, among which the most closely related is lung cancer. In addition, because carcinogenic substances can be absorbed by the lungs and cause systemic harm, it can induce laryngeal cancer, esophageal cancer, oral cancer, bladder cancer, kidney cancer, pancreatic cancer and so on. The second is environmental pollution. Relevant data show that air pollution is one of the causes of lung cancer. Environmental pollution is no less harmful to people’s lungs than smoking.
